Essential Guide to Concealed Cistern Accessories for Modern Bathrooms
Concealed cisterns have gained popularity in modern bathroom design due to their sleek appearance and space-saving capabilities. However, the effectiveness of a concealed cistern largely depends on the quality and compatibility of its accessories. Understanding the various concealed cistern accessories is essential for professionals in the architectural and decorative materials industry, as these components can significantly impact both the functionality and longevity of a bathroom installation.
One of the primary accessories for concealed cisterns is the flush plate. This component allows users to activate the flushing mechanism while adding an aesthetic touch to the bathroom. Flush plates come in various designs, materials, and finishes, enabling customization that aligns with the overall design theme of the space. Professionals should consider the ergonomics and accessibility of the flush plate design, ensuring that it is easy to operate for all users. Additionally, some flush plates offer dual flush options, which can contribute to water conservation efforts—a growing concern in today's environmentally-conscious market.
Another critical accessory is the inlet valve, which regulates the water flow into the cistern. A quality inlet valve minimizes noise during filling and prevents leaks, which can be a significant concern in any bathroom setting. When selecting an inlet valve, it is crucial to ensure compatibility with the specific cistern model and to consider features such as adjustable float settings for optimal performance.
Furthermore, the siphon is another vital component that directly affects the flushing efficiency of concealed cisterns. It creates a vacuum that effectively removes waste from the toilet bowl. Professionals should be aware of the different types of siphons available, including those designed for low water usage, which can be particularly beneficial in modern eco-friendly renovations.
Installation accessories, such as brackets and mounting frames, are also essential for ensuring that the concealed cistern is securely fixed to the wall. Proper installation is key to preventing future issues such as leaks and misalignment. It is advisable to follow the manufacturer's guidelines closely and consider the structural integrity of the wall where the cistern will be installed.
Lastly, maintenance accessories, such as service valves and access panels, facilitate easy access to the cistern for repairs and regular maintenance. These components can save time and reduce costs in the long run by allowing for straightforward troubleshooting without the need to dismantle extensive bathroom fixtures.
In summary, understanding concealed cistern accessories is vital for professionals in the building and decorative materials industry. By selecting the right components, you can enhance the performance, reliability, and aesthetic appeal of modern bathrooms. Whether it’s optimizing water efficiency or ensuring ease of maintenance, the right accessories will make a significant difference in the overall functionality of concealed cisterns.
